However keep in mind, Lake Tahoe winter weddings can be subject to their own seasonal challenges.  Many a happy couple has had to navigate stormy weather to get to their wedding on time.  Brides often have to find practical (yet elegant ways) to keep warm, while not detracting from the overall look and feel of the occasion.  A winter bride may want to consider including a cloak, cape, shrug, shawl, wrap, bolero, or f aux fur stole to her wardrobe.

Certainly each and every delay or potential snag cannot be foreseen.  However, having a little peace-of-mind ahead of time can prove to be priceless if the occasion should call for it.  Before scheduling a winter wedding, having a Plan “B”, just in case things are not pulled off as smoothly as planned can surely be a good thing.  So as not to have a stranded bridal party (especially the bride and groom) , an alternate means  of transportation may need to be kept at the ready; and contracts made with any venue scheduled to host the reception will need to be examined for clauses that detail what would happen in the event of unavoidable tardiness or a cancellation.  Maintaining a list of things that need to be taken into consideration is a great way to keep track.  In the meantime, enjoy planning your winter wedding while not forgetting to set a place for Mother Nature….keeping in mind that she reserves the right to be the ultimate Wedding Crasher. If you are not sure how to dress for a Lake Tahoe winter wedding think about you and your sweetie in the elegant look of old Hollywood; the groom in tails, and the bride in a white long silk dress with a white fur or faux fur wrap. Evoke the season with “ice” diamonds or diamond-like jewelry. 90% of wedding dresses are strapless or sleeveless, but that’s not so practical for a bride who wants to take pictures outside, or needs to walk any distance. Look for wraps, shrugs, and capes, or dramatic coats. I’ve always loved the look of a bride in a white dress and a large red shawl, huddled against her groom who has a red boutonnière. And don’t forget your bridesmaids! An attractive wrap to wear on the day of your wedding and beyond makes a great bridesmaid present.

For a romantic Lake Tahoe winter wedding look for a venue with a fireplace. A fireplace makes for an intimate Tahoe winter wedding. For a larger affair, you may be able to use a historic mansion or private club that will still have intimate warmth.

Unless you’re getting married in a state that will have guaranteed snow during your wedding date, avoid a room that has a large picture window. You may imagine drifts of beautiful snow, and end up with a grey rainy day. Be sure to ask what seasonal decorations they use – you’ll save money as many sites are already heavily decorated. Also, check to make sure your site will be adequately heated during the winter months; some old venues can be especially drafty.

If you are planning a reception afterwards, you can have all of your favorite food but add some winter touches like a squash dish, or warm pumpkin soup. Consider serving eggnog, spiced wine, or hot chocolate (alcoholic or non-) as special treats. Look for an all-white cake, decorated with snowflake patterns, silver embellishments, or sugar sculptures. Our staff will help finding the just the right caterer.

Having a fall wedding in Lake Tahoe is one of the most popular times to plan a wedding — and for good reason!  Gorgeous natural foliage and just the right daytime temperate weather make for great fall weddings throughout the Tahoe basin. Here in the Tahoe basin 14% of weddings take place during the September months, 12% take place in October, and 6% in November.

But for all of autumn’s positive attributes, there are still potential issues that you need to keep in mind while planning a fall wedding in Lake Tahoe. First, keep in mind that even if guests are comfortable at your afternoon wedding ceremony, they need to prepare for the temperature to drop in the evening. One idea we encourage to our clients is to arrange bins of inexpensive wraps at the reception entrance, or set up heat lamps in outdoor areas where guests will want to relax. You could even embrace the season with a few fire pits surrounding the venue if you plan to have your wedding at one of our many  Tahoe scenic wedding locations. To see a current list of all our year round indoor and outdoor scenic wedding locations all you need to do is go to our web-site www.TahoeMountainWeddingChapel.com

Another common obstacle is fall wedding flowers for brides planning a fall wedding in Lake Tahoe. Though many popular wedding blooms are not in season during this time of the year, this is the perfect opportunity to get creative with a fall wedding bouquet. Incorporate unexpected plants like wheat, crab apples, and ornamental vegetables.

Finally, remember to do your research when selecting a date for an autumn fall wedding in Lake Tahoe. There are many holidays during the fall — including Labor Day, Thanksgiving, and the Jewish high holidays — but by doing your research you can help your guests avoid scheduling conflicts. Emerald Bay is the most iconic of all Lake Tahoe landmarks. It’s one of the most photographed and visited locations in the region.

Emerald Bay is available year round for weddings, this 593 acre state park located on the southwest shore of the Lake Tahoe basin and has been designated as a National Natural Landmark for its brilliant panorama of snow capped mountains and glacier carved granite and a flowing waterfall in the spring and early summer.  This venue is spectacular any time of the day or year.  It is a thrill to see this venue from the 200 foot cliff overlooking the lake. Mile marker 53, which is directly in the middle between the two scenic lookout points, is one of our favorite spots to take small casual groups looking to be married.  This unique spot offers the most breathtaking spectacular panoramic lake views of Tahoe atop a 500-foot bluff.
